Buying a IS250 RWD in SoCal

I really love these cars, and I am looking to downsize from my truck to get some better gas mileage. I currently pay around $350 a month for my truck, and would like to keep payments close to the same, maybe a little bit higher. If I am looking at a MSRP about $35,000 and putting $3000 down, do you think it is possibe to get a monthly payment close to what I'm looking at. I have very good credit and everything. Thanks for the help. I just don't want to go in with an unreasonable sense of mind.

i think it's going to be tight. i would tend to think around 450 a month at least, but that's with my rough calculation. it doesn't hurt to ask and see what price they are willing to sell you the car for, and what rates they have out there now.

economy is slow, dealerships want to deal
